微前端框架之王:Wujie 带你领略全栈开发新高度
2022-12-07 17:15:38
Wujie:微前端框架的集大成者
踏入微前端开发的时代,Wujie 凭借其卓越的性能和创新的设计,在众多前端框架中脱颖而出,成为当之无愧的王者。它以 WebComponent 容器为基础,巧妙地将微应用封装成独立组件,如同积木般灵活组装,让跨团队协作和模块化架构的无缝衔接成为可能。
多维度突破:Wujie 的制胜之道
组件隔离,引领开发新时代
Wujie 为每个微应用提供了独立的运行空间,如同在广阔的舞台上,每个组件自成一体,互不干扰,尽情展现各自风采。样式隔离、运行性能保障和页面白屏问题的彻底解决,让开发者们拍手称绝,尽情发挥创意,将应用程序搭建得更加精妙绝伦。
通信无忧,共筑和谐前端生态
Wujie 为微应用之间的通信搭建了一座桥梁,使得不同组件之间能够轻松传递消息,如同穿梭于繁华都市的列车,畅通无阻。子应用通信、子应用保活和多应用激活等功能的全面支持,让前端开发从此告别孤岛,携手共进,迸发出无穷的创造力。
Vite 框架加持,开发效率倍增
Wujie 紧跟时代潮流,将 Vite 框架纳入麾下,为开发者提供了一条高速公路,大幅提升开发效率。从项目构建到热更新,一切变得如此丝滑流畅,如同行云流水,让开发者们尽享开发的乐趣,释放无限的潜能。
应用共享,共享资源共享智慧
Wujie 鼓励应用之间的资源共享,如同一个紧密团结的大家庭,资源共享,互利共赢。应用程序组件能够在不同的微应用中无缝复用,如同共享一座座宝库,节约开发成本,加快开发进度,让整个团队的智慧凝聚成一张无坚不摧的网。
Wujie:全栈开发的得力助手
Wujie 不仅是微前端开发的领军者,更是全栈开发的得力助手。它将前端开发的复杂性降到最低,让开发者能够专注于业务逻辑和创新,如同一位尽职尽责的管家,为开发团队保驾护航,让全栈开发的道路变得更加顺畅。
代码示例
// 主应用中创建一个 WebComponent 容器
const container = document.createElement('div');
container.id = 'micro-app';
document.body.appendChild(container);
// 加载微应用
const microApp = document.createElement('micro-app');
microApp.setAttribute('src', 'http://localhost:3000');
container.appendChild(microApp);
// 卸载微应用
microApp.remove();
常见问题解答
-
Wujie 与其他微前端框架有何不同?
Wujie 采用 WebComponent 容器作为基石,为每个微应用提供独立的运行空间,注重组件隔离和通信畅通。 -
使用 Wujie 能带来哪些好处?
使用 Wujie 可以提升开发效率、实现跨团队协作、模块化架构、共享资源和优化全栈开发体验。 -
Wujie 是否支持 SSR?
目前 Wujie 尚未支持 SSR,但开发者可以借助第三方工具或插件实现 SSR 功能。 -
如何解决 Wujie 中的跨域问题?
可以配置 CORS 头部或使用代理服务器来解决 Wujie 中的跨域问题。 -
Wujie 是否有活跃的社区支持?
Wujie 拥有活跃的社区,开发者可以参与 GitHub 讨论、Stack Overflow 提问和参加社区活动。
结语
Wujie,这个微前端框架界的黑马,以其强大的功能和贴心的设计,征服了无数前端开发者的芳心。如果你正在寻找一款能够助你驰骋微前端开发领域的利器,那么 Wujie 绝对是你的不二之选。它将带你领略全栈开发的新高度,让你的开发之旅更加精彩纷呈。